Source: gnome-shell
Version: 48~rc-2
Severity: minor

-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E-----
Hash: SHA256

The 'homepage' link points to https://wiki.gnome.org/Projects/GnomeShell
but when you navigate to that page, you'll see a banner at the top

  This site has been retired. For up to date information, see
  handbook.gnome.org or gitlab.gnome.org.

One possible alternative could be
https://gitlab.gnome.org/GNOME/gnome-shell/

But feel free to pick a better one ;-)

Changes:
 gnome-shell (48.3-1)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   * Team upload
   * New upstream stable release
     - Accessibility improvements (LP: #2115948)
       + In the Alt+F2 "run" dialog, provide the dialog title to screen
         readers and other accessibility tools (gnome-shell!3736 upstream)
       + In the calendar/notifications menu, label the Events and Weather
         areas for accessibility tools (gnome-shell!3769 upstream)
       + In popup menus, tell accessibility tools that separators are
         not useful to select (gnome-shell!3773 upstream)
       + In text entry widgets, send the hint (placeholder text) to
         accessibility tools (gnome-shell!3179 upstream)
       + In text entry widgets, make the label available to accessibility
         tools (gnome-shell!3179 upstream)
       + When running as a gdm greeter, if there is an error such as a wrong
         password, send it to the screen reader as well as displaying it
         (gnome-shell!3765 upstream)
     - When prompting for a password change via Gcr, if the repeated password
       doesn't match, re-enable the UI widgets so the user can try again
       (gnome-shell!3757 upstream)
     - Always update on-screen keyboard layout to reflect the purpose hint,
       so that the expected features appear (alphanumeric vs. numeric-only,
       emoji chooser shown or hidden, etc.)
       (gnome-shell#8377 upstream)
     - Limit the length of the input method indicator by counting grapheme
       clusters rather than UTF-16 string lengths, allowing input methods like
       ibus-typing-booster to use emoji as their indicator
       (gnome-shell#1026 upstream)
     - Avoid the top bar disappearing when doing a 3-finger downward swipe
       gesture on a touchscreen
       (gnome-shell#7456 upstream)
     - If Decibels is installed, put it in the Utilities folder as intended
       (Decibels is not yet in Debian, ITP: #1100886)
       (gnome-shell!3728 upstream)
     - If the mouse button modifier (normally Super, i.e. the Windows key)
       is set to a combination of modifiers such as <Control><Super>, only
       make the mouse wheel switch between desktops if *all* of those
       modifiers are held
       (mutter#4129 upstream)
     - Avoid flooding the systemd journal with old time-limit transitions if
       debug messages are enabled
       (gnome-shell!3740 upstream)
     - Reuse one proxy object for all communication with the gdm greeter,
       which is more efficient and can mitigate per-connection memory
       leaks in gdm
       (gnome-shell!3749 upstream)
     - Better build-time compatibility with non-glibc libc
       (gnome-shell#8457 upstream, no practical effect on Debian)
     - Remove redundant eslint hints
       (gnome-shell!3756 upstream, no practical effect since they're comments)
     - Translation updates
     - CI changes with no effect on Debian
   * d/patches: Re-export patch series (no functional changes)
   * d/control: Update Homepage field (Closes: #1100764)
